Transaction 63f71acae6c50691def770b7f1fcf93770fffbc2c72d813130b4a50544bed8de
1 Input
2 Outputs
- 63f71acae6c50691def770b7f1fcf93770fffbc2c72d813130b4a50544bed8de:0
- 63f71acae6c50691def770b7f1fcf93770fffbc2c72d813130b4a50544bed8de:1
value 149708
address 1EfXFsHDMczdWNqNiwoyWe2kitqU7UuACc
value 19885591063
address 1CNGEPgqTx62VhhPmi4t5tqx22vDZ6GWuu